How they compare

Mauritania currently reports 176.18 against 175.44 in Poland, a difference of 0.74.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 39 shared years of data; in 1987 it was Mauritania ahead.

Mauritania ranks 67th and Poland ranks 68th of 157 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Mauritania averaged higher in 4 and Poland in 1.

The consumer price index reflects the change in prices for the average consumer of a constant basket of consumer goods. Data is not seasonally adjusted.
